Using audio noise for generating random key stream
Steam ciphers systems are widely used in cryptography applications due to low possibility of propagating errors, ease of implementation and high processing speed. A stream cipher is an encryption process where random binary stream keys combine with the plaintext to produce cipher text. The stream ci...
Gespeichert in:
Veröffentlicht in: | IOP conference series. Materials Science and Engineering 2021-03, Vol.1090 (1), p.12136 |
---|---|
1. Verfasser: | |
Format: | Artikel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| Steam ciphers systems are widely used in cryptography applications due to low possibility of propagating errors, ease of implementation and high processing speed. A stream cipher is an encryption process where random binary stream keys combine with the plaintext to produce cipher text. The stream cipher systems encrypt bits of plaintext individually by adding bits from a key stream to plaintext bits. The security of a cipher text fully depends on the key stream. Therefore, generating a long unpredictable sequence of binary bits used as the encryption key is the main topic in stream cipher systems. This paper focuses on generating a stream of binary keys using audio noise and subjected the generated keys to several local randomness tests such as; frequency test, serial test, Poker test and Autocorrelation test. The randomness tests show that the generated keys contain good statistical characteristics and high security makes them suitable to be used in stream cipher systems. |
---|---|
ISSN: | 1757-8981 1757-899X |
DOI: | 10.1088/1757-899X/1090/1/012136 |